Built - c1785, Cloister Group, 40X80, 3.5, stone
mill.
|
|
|
AKA - Lower Cloister Mill
|
|
|
Records show a Krubs' mill on this site after
1736. It was a 40X80, 1.5 story linestone mill. A
second story was later added by a Eckerling.
Cloister purchased the land in 1741 without mention
of the mill. The mill was last operated by Samuel
Mentzler in 1915 when it started to produce
electricity. In 1970 through the mid 1990s it was
vacant and standing with staging in the front. In
2004 preservation measures have taken place.
Condition - Good
